About

Upton-upon-Severn is a riverside town on a pronounced bend of the River Severn, historically a crossing point and inland port. Its streets lead down to a large riverside green and a distinctive, solitary church tower, all that remains of its former parish church after a flood. The surrounding flat, often water-meadow landscape is defined by the river's course and the raised earthworks of flood defences, creating a distinct separation between the settlement and the agricultural land.

The villages of Welland and Eldersfield occupy slightly higher ground on the river's eastern flank, where the first gentle folds of the Malvern Hills begin to rise. Welland sits at the foot of the hills, with Eldersfield positioned on a ridge overlooking the Severn valley. This area is characterised by narrow, hedge-lined lanes connecting scattered farms and orchards, with the steep, wooded slopes of the Herefordshire Beacon forming a clear western horizon. The annual Upton Jazz Festival brings a temporary, concentrated energy to the otherwise quiet, working landscape.

Area overview

On average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 37 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 10.1%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ield is £51,444 per year. There are 6 schools in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ield: 6 primary (1 Outstanding and 5 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ield is home to around 7,250 people, with a population density of about 74.3 per km2.

Property prices in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ield

Based on 78 recent sales, the median property price is £317,500 in Upton-upon-Severn, Welland & Eldersfield area, with individual transactions ranging from £81,000 up to £1,075,000.
